The Kansas City Chiefs are coming off a brutal loss to the Baltimore Ravens, a 36-35 setback caused by a late fumble. It was Patrick Mahomes' first loss to the Ravens and Lamar Jackson. The Chiefs now move on to face their division rival in the Los Angeles Chargers.

The Chargers sit at 1-1 on the season and are following a 20-17 loss to the Dallas Cowboys. While the Chargers aren't a favorite like the Chiefs in the AFC, they are loaded with talent on both sides of the ball. Budding star Justin Herbert has followed up his record-breaking rookie campaign with solid performances through the first two weeks. He hasn't played at the level people were expecting, but that could all change against the Chiefs.

This game is primed to be a significant clash between the two division rivals.

Chiefs Week 3 Predictions

4. Tyrann Mathieu picks off Justin Herbert

Tyrann Mathieu is one of the best safeties in the NFL, and he has shown that this season. Through the first two games, Mathieu has two interceptions and a touchdown. He is the leader of the Chiefs secondary and is always ready to make a play.

Herbert has also struggled with turnovers so far this season. He has thrown three interceptions to only two touchdowns. It's been a slow start for Herbert, and Mathieu needs to take advantage of that and force a turnover.

3. Travis Kelce goes over 100 yards

Travis Kelce is simply one of the best weapons in the NFL. He is a model of consistency as he has gone for over 1,000 yards every season since 2016. Kelce has kept up the same level of play this season as he had seven receptions for 109 yards and a touchdown last week. Even though teams come up with a gameplan to neutralize Kelce, he has proven time and time again that he will still put up numbers.

2. Chiefs win in a close game

Although the Chargers have a good roster, the Chiefs should still pull out the win. The Chiefs have been in the Conference Championship every year since Mahomes took over, and they look ready to get back to that stage again. Despite the loss to the Ravens last week, Mahomes and the Chiefs are still the team to beat in the AFC.

However, it is not going to be a blowout victory for the Chiefs. The Chargers improved their team drastically in the offseason, which makes them a potential Wild Card team. Herbert has an improved offensive line as well as a more talented defense to back him up. Look for the Chiefs to pick up the win in a tightly contested game.

1. Patrick Mahomes throws four touchdowns

Patrick Mahomes has shown once again why he is one of the best players in the league. Mahomes has thrown for 680 yards, six touchdowns, and only one interception through his first two games. He has shown the ability to carve up opposing defenses, and he will have that opportunity against the Chargers. The Chargers improved unit has looked good, but containing Mahomes is a different task.

Mahomes has the weapons in Tyreek Hill and Kelce to shred this Chargers defense. The Chiefs revamped offensive line will give him time to throw to his targets downfield. Look for Mahomes to have a dominant showing against the Chargers.
